Fun things about Hilton Head: There were lots of forests with oak trees with moss (hair hanging down because they needed a haircut), No lights at night because of the sea turtles which made it very hard to find anything after 5!, Great place to go even if you never play golf, outlet shops, Lots of fun little villages, great beaches, and Super yummy seafood!
